Application Notes
-
Approved: IF (1:50 - 1:500), IHC, IHC-P (1:100 - 1:500)
Usage: Immunohistochemistry: Antigen retrieval is recommended. Antigen retrieval with Tris-EDTA pH 9.0 buffer will enhance staining. Likely to work with frozen sections. In some cases, the antibody may be diluted further than indicated. Human controls: Breast Carcinoma, Colon Carcinoma, Ovarian Carcinoma, Prostate Carcinoma, Testicular Seminoma. -
